This thread has been locked.
If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.
大家好,我必须在单线总线上进行从3.3V 到5V 的电平转换(主板上有两条1线)。
我发现了几个看起来合适的部件,我希望确保我做出正确的选择。
我认为 LSF0102应该是好的,否则 TXS0102E 似乎也是一个可能的选择。 我也考虑过 PCA9306,即使它是针对 I2C 的,我认为它也应该起作用,这是正确的吗?
使用 LSF0102 执行此功能是否正常? 还是有更好的选择?
谢谢,
密海
您好,密海
是的,这些设备可以支持高达5 V 的双向漏极开路转换。如果这是单线总线的工作方式,那么我在使用上述3种设备中的任何一种都看不到问题。 如果您计划使用自己的部署,我推荐使用 LSF0102。 TXS0102将具有内部10K 扩展,并且不需要在线路上进行外部扩展。
您好迪伦,非常感谢您的快速响应。
这种情况有点复杂,因为客户还需要在“转换”端支持3.3V。
因此,设备必须连接到微控制器一侧(A 侧)的3.3V,并在“转换”一侧(B 侧)支持5V 和3.3V。
我更详细地了解了 LSF0102,要求 B 侧的 A 电压比 A 侧高大约1V。
是否有一个设备(来自上述三个选项或其他选项)可以支持此功能? 据我了解 ,TXS0102 还支持 VCCA=VCCB 的操作? 最好是进行外部引体向上,但我们也可以考虑采用内部引体向上的解决方案。
谢谢,
密海
LSF 要求两个 VREF 电压不相同。 如果您有5 V 电源,也可以将其用于3.3 V 数据。
但对于低速信号,使用 LSF 有一种更简单的方法:A1/B1处的数据(两侧都有上拉电阻器),保持 Vref_A/B 打开,并将 EN 直接连接到最低的电源。
大家好,谢谢你的回答,你写道“LSF 只要求两个 VREF 电压不同”,但问题是——正如我在上面所写的——我们也可能会遇到两个 VREF 电压相同(3.3V)的情况。
此外,您提到的第二点 “将 EN 连接到最低的电源。” 如果双方都有3.3V 电压,我认为这是行不通的,这是正确的吗?
谢谢,
密海
如果您的 B 电源电压不高于3.3 V,则无法将其连接至 Vref_B
只有在使用 Vref 引脚时,该限制才适用。 如果您保持 Vref 引脚打开并将 EN 直接连接到3.3 V 电源,则所有信号都可以低至3.3 V (但开关电容更高)。
大家好,我已将设备更新为 TXS0101,因为这台设备还应该在两侧使用相同的电压来支持机箱,而且使用起来似乎更简单。 如果我们需要较小的上拉,我们将在内部10K 的同时增加外部上拉。
我认为这对这项申请应该是有效的,请你确认吗?
谢谢,
密海